Kinetic Theory and Fluid Dynamics by Yoshio Sone
English | PDF EPUB (True) | 2002 | 358 Pages | ISBN : 0817642846 | 30.2 MB

This monograph is intended to provide a comprehensive description of the rela­ tion between kinetic theory and fluid dynamics for a time-independent behavior of a gas in a general domain. A gas in a steady (or time-independent) state in a general domain is considered, and its asymptotic behavior for small Knudsen numbers is studied on the basis of kinetic theory. Fluid-dynamic-type equations and their associated boundary conditions, together with their Knudsen-layer corrections, describing the asymptotic behavior of the gas for small Knudsen numbers are presented.

Kinetic Theory of Gases in Shear Flows: Nonlinear Transport by Vicente Garzó
English | PDF | 2003 | 353 Pages | ISBN : 9048163471 | 31.1 MB

The kinetic theory of gases as we know it dates to the paper of Boltzmann in 1872. The justification and context of this equation has been clarified over the past half century to the extent that it comprises one of the most complete examples of many-body analyses exhibiting the contraction from a microscopic to a mesoscopic description.
